Output db4afff62a31df6e396e7bfe6bd89fd7b76d564512960aa0dfbf8338a1280b82:0

value
655500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bccf89644f58f442a269628942dce039be36876 OP_EQUAL
address
MDMMePLUv88ut828Vf2LXJZLWtoiGkJRSw
transaction
db4afff62a31df6e396e7bfe6bd89fd7b76d564512960aa0dfbf8338a1280b82
spent
true